Home
Blog
Medicine Search
Medicine A-Z List
Home
Medicine Search
Price Comparison
Domtidin 30mg20mg Tablet Sr Vega Laboratories Pvt Ltd 65cf60e42093e966653ae1c3
domtidin 30mg20mg tablet sr
price list India
vega laboratories pvt ltd